Hinge clamping seat structure for fixing water outlet pipe of automobile

By using a hinged bracket structure to pre-position the water outlet pipe and a hinged folding hook to fix it, the problem of the water outlet pipe loosening and falling off during vibration is solved, ensuring the normal spraying of the washer fluid and improving driving safety.

Abstract

The application discloses a hinge clasp seat structure for fixing a water outlet pipe of an automobile, and belongs to the field of automobile accessories. The hinge clasp seat structure solves the problem that the water outlet pipe is loose or falls off due to deformation of a clasp and vibration during automobile driving in the prior art. In the technical scheme of the application, one end of a first connecting support rib and a second connecting support rib is fixedly connected with a clasp base, a water outlet pipe positioning groove is arranged between the other end of the first connecting support rib and the second connecting support rib, and the opening of the water outlet pipe positioning groove is located between the end portions of the first connecting support rib and the second connecting supporting rib; the hinge clasp assembly is arranged at the opening of the water outlet pipe positioning groove; the third connecting support rib is arc-shaped, is arranged between the second connecting support rib and the clasp base, and two ends of the third connecting support rib are fixedly connected with the second connecting support rib and the clasp base respectively. The technical scheme of the application can pre-position and pre-fix the water pipe, and then strongly fix the water pipe through the hinge type hundred-fold clasp, so that the water pipe is firm, reliable, not loose and not fallen off.

Technical Field

[0001] This invention relates to a hinged bracket structure for fixing a water outlet pipe in an automobile, belonging to the field of automotive parts. Background Technology

[0002] As the safety standards of windshield wiper systems continue to improve, the requirements for the cleanliness of the windshield are also increasing. When there are stains on the windshield, washer fluid can be sprayed through the wiper nozzles, and then the wipers can be used to repeatedly wipe away the stains, thus ensuring clear visibility for the driver and driving safety. The washer fluid sprayed by the wiper nozzles is delivered from the washer fluid reservoir in the engine compartment through a washer fluid outlet pipe. The washer fluid outlet pipe is fixedly clipped into the vehicle body. In existing technology, a hook and slot method is used to fix the washer fluid outlet pipe. However, due to deformation of the hooks and vibrations during vehicle operation, the outlet pipe may loosen or fall off, causing an open circuit in the pipeline between the wiper nozzles and the washer fluid reservoir, preventing washer fluid spraying. If there are stains on the windshield, they cannot be removed in this situation, resulting in obstructed driver vision and posing a driving safety hazard. Summary of the Invention

[0003] This invention provides a hinged bracket structure for fixing a car water outlet pipe. The water pipe is first pre-positioned and pre-fixed, and then the water pipe is strongly fixed by a hinged folding hook, which is firm, reliable, and will not loosen or fall off.

[0021] Example 1

[0022] This embodiment is a hinged bracket structure for fixing a water outlet pipe in an automobile, including a bracket base 1 and a water outlet pipe bracket, the water outlet pipe bracket being disposed on the bracket base 1; the water outlet pipe bracket includes a first connecting support rib 2, a second connecting support rib 3, a third connecting support rib 4, a water outlet pipe positioning groove 5, and a hinge buckle assembly; the first connecting support rib 2 and the second connecting support rib 3 are spaced apart, one end of the first connecting support rib 2 and the second connecting support rib 3 is fixedly connected to the bracket base 1, the water outlet pipe positioning groove 5 is disposed between the other ends of the first connecting support rib 2 and the second connecting support rib 3, and the opening of the water outlet pipe positioning groove 5 is located between the ends of the first connecting support rib 2 and the second connecting support rib 3; the hinge buckle assembly is disposed at the opening of the water outlet pipe positioning groove 5; the third connecting support rib 3 is arc-shaped, the third connecting support rib 3 is disposed between the second connecting support rib 3 and the bracket base 1, and both ends are fixedly connected to the second connecting support rib 3 and the bracket base 1 respectively.

[0023] The base 1 of the card holder is connected to the water outlet pipe positioning groove 5 and the hinge buckle assembly through connecting support rib 1 2, connecting support rib 2 3, and connecting support rib 3 4. The shape of the connecting support rib 3 4 is an arc transition connection, which ensures the connection strength between the water outlet pipe positioning groove 5, the hinge buckle assembly and the card holder base 1, and fixes the relative position of the water outlet pipe positioning groove 5, the hinge buckle assembly and the card holder base 1.

[0024] The arc-shaped opening of the connecting support rib 3 4 faces the connection point between the connecting support rib 2 3 and the card seat base 1. The connecting support rib 1 2 and the connecting support rib 2 3 are set at an acute angle; the connecting support rib 2 3 and the card seat base 1 are set at an acute angle; the connecting support rib 3 4 is set within the acute angle between the connecting support rib 2 3 and the card seat base 1.

[0025] The connecting support rib 3 4 supports the space between the connecting support rib 2 3 and the card seat base 1. The connecting support rib 3 4 adopts an arc transition, which can provide part of the elastic recovery force when elastic deformation occurs between the connecting support rib 2 3 and the card seat base 1, and make the connecting support rib 2 3 and the card seat base 1 have sufficient rigidity and connection strength.

[0026] The outlet pipe positioning groove 5 is U-shaped, and the ends of the connecting support rib 1 2 and the connecting support rib 2 3 are fixedly connected to the U-shaped bottom end face of the outlet pipe positioning groove 5 respectively; the outlet pipe positioning groove 5 is integrally formed with the connecting support rib 1 2 and the connecting support rib 2 3.

[0027] The outlet pipe positioning groove 5 serves as the positioning body for the outlet pipe. It adopts a U-shape and is integrally formed with the connecting support rib 1 2 and the connecting support rib 2 3, so that the outlet pipe positioning groove 5 and the connecting support rib 1 2 and the connecting support rib 2 3 have sufficient connection strength, reducing stress concentration at the connection.

[0028] The outlet pipe positioning groove 5 is provided with a pre-clamping rib 1 6 and a pre-clamping rib 2 7, which are respectively set on the inner walls on both sides of the opening end of the outlet pipe positioning groove 5; the distance between the ends of the pre-clamping rib 1 6 and the pre-clamping rib 2 7 is less than the outer diameter of the outlet pipe.

[0029] Applying a small force to the water outlet pipe allows it to be pressed into the water outlet pipe positioning groove 5. Simultaneously, the pre-clamping ribs 1 and 2 are designed with a reverse clamping structure, ensuring initial clamping of the water outlet pipe and preventing it from falling out of the positioning groove 5 during assembly. Furthermore, during vehicle operation, the pre-clamping ribs 1 and 2 can further tighten and secure the water outlet pipe, improving its stability.

[0030] The hinge buckle assembly includes a water outlet pipe fixing hook 8. One end of the water outlet pipe fixing hook 8 is hinged to the end of the connecting support rib 2 3 by a zigzag hinge 11. The other end of the water outlet pipe fixing hook 8 is provided with a hook head 9. The end of the connecting support rib 2 is provided with a snap-fit ​​protrusion 10 that cooperates with the hook head 9.

[0031] After the water outlet pipe is pre-positioned and pre-clamped by pre-clamping ribs 1 and 2, the water outlet pipe hook 8 is fixed. It bends via the zigzag hinge 11 and then engages with the engagement protrusion 10 of the connecting support rib 12, thus forcibly fixing the water outlet pipe and ensuring it will not loosen or fall off. The hook head 9 at the end of the water outlet pipe hook 8 can bend under force, and after bending, it makes firm contact with the engagement protrusion 10, giving the water outlet pipe excellent fixation stability after fixing.

[0032] The card base 1, connecting support rib 1, connecting support rib 2, connecting support rib 3, connecting support rib 4, water outlet pipe positioning groove 5, and water outlet pipe fixing hook 8 are integrally formed.

[0033] In this embodiment, the entire hinge bracket structure can be made into a single piece, which can ensure the connection strength between the various parts of the hinge bracket structure and prevent stress concentration at the connection points of the various parts.

[0034] The first connecting support rib 2 includes a connecting segment 2-1 and a supporting segment 2-2. The end of the connecting segment 2-1 is connected to the base 1 of the card seat, and the thickness of the connecting segment 2-1 is less than the thickness of the supporting segment 2-2. The second connecting support rib 3 includes a connecting segment 3-1 and a supporting segment 3-2. The end of the connecting segment 3-1 is connected to the base 1 of the card seat, and the thickness of the connecting segment 3-1 is less than the thickness of the supporting segment 3-2.

[0035] Example 2

[0036] The difference between this embodiment and embodiment 1 is that: the water outlet pipe positioning groove 5 includes an arc-shaped elastic sheet, which is disposed between the ends of the connecting support rib 1 2 and the connecting support rib 2 3. The water outlet pipe positioning groove 5 is formed by the inner surface of the end of the connecting support rib 1 2, the inner surface of the end of the connecting support rib 2 3, and the inner surface of the arc-shaped opening of the elastic sheet to form a U-shaped groove; the water outlet pipe positioning groove 5 is integrally formed with the connecting support rib 1 2 and the connecting support rib 2 3.

[0037] The first connecting support rib 2 includes a connecting segment 2-1 and a supporting segment 2-2. The end of the connecting segment 2-1 is connected to the base 1 of the card seat, and the thickness of the connecting segment 2-1 is less than the thickness of the supporting segment 2-2. The second connecting support rib 3 includes a connecting segment 3-1 and a supporting segment 3-2. The end of the connecting segment 3-1 is connected to the base 1 of the card seat, and the thickness of the connecting segment 3-1 is less than the thickness of the supporting segment 3-2.

[0038] In this embodiment, the water outlet pipe positioning groove 5 is formed by an elastic sheet, connecting support rib 1 2, and connecting support rib 2 3. The supporting sections 2-2 and 3-2 of connecting support rib 1 2 and connecting support rib 2 3 are relatively thick, which can ensure that the water outlet pipe positioning groove 5 has good clamping and fixing strength for the water outlet pipe. The connecting sections 2-1 and 3-1 of connecting support rib 1 2 and connecting support rib 2 3 are relatively thin and have good elasticity. When the vehicle vibrates, connecting sections 2-1 and 3-1 can reduce the impact of vibration on the water outlet pipe fixing structure through elastic deformation, and reduce the transmission of vibration energy.
